Web14 feb. 2024 · 10’x10’ first-story deck: $3,000–$6,000. 10’x10’ second-story deck: $3,800–$8,000. Framing. Framing a deck, which sets the joints of the unit to be structurally safe and sound, costs $9 to $12 for labor per square foot. The lumber or materials needed to frame your deck accounts for about ¼ to ⅓ of the lumber you’ll need. Flooring WebManufacturers' warranties for hardwood decking are generally only against rot and decay, and only apply to naturally durable hardwoods such as Ipe, Cumaru, Batu, Red Balau, Yellow Balau, Massaranduba, Manilkara, Merbau and Angelim Pedra. Because it is such a high-quality wood, mahogany decking can be quite expensive, with prices ranging from $15 to $30 per square foot. The average cost of installing a 20 x 20 deck is $14,970. christian mirch omahaWeb11 apr. 2024 · On average, a pressure-treated wood deck will cost between $15 to $25 per square foot including installation. A cedar wood deck will cost $30 or more per square foot. A composite deck will cost $30 to $60 per square foot installed.
